Common Oak Floor Installation Jobs
Solid Oak Flooring - ideal for enhancing the durability and classic appearance of living spaces.
Engineered Oak Flooring - suitable for areas with fluctuating humidity and temperature conditions.
Prefinished Oak Floors - offer quick installation with minimal finishing required after placement.
Unfinished Oak Flooring - provides the option for custom staining and finishing to match existing decor.
Glue-Down Oak Installation - recommended for a secure, stable floor in concrete or slab foundations.
Nail-Down Oak Flooring - traditional method suitable for wood subfloors to ensure long-lasting results.
Oak Floor Installation Questions
What types of wood are suitable for oak floor installation? Common options include red oak, white oak, and engineered oak, each offering different durability and appearance options for homes in Phoenix.
Is underlayment necessary for oak flooring? Yes, an appropriate underlayment helps with moisture control, soundproofing, and provides a smooth surface for oak flooring installation.
Can oak flooring be installed over existing floors? In some cases, oak flooring can be installed over existing surfaces like concrete or wood, but proper assessment is recommended to ensure compatibility.
What preparation is needed before installing oak floors?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ure a proper and long-lasting installation of oak flooring.
